La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
EFM8UB20F64G-B-QFP48R

EFM8UB20F64G-B-QFP48R

Product Overview

Category

The EFM8UB20F64G-B-QFP48R bel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and systems for control and processing purposes.

Characteristics

  • High-performance 8-bit microcontroller
  • Low power consumption
  • Small form factor
  • Integrated peripherals for enhanced functionality
  • Robust communication interfaces
  • Extensive memory options

Package

The EFM8UB20F64G-B-QFP48R comes in a QFP48 package, which stands for Quad Flat Package with 48 pins.

Essence

The essence of this microcontroller lies in its ability to provide efficient and reliable control and processing capabilities for electronic devices.

Packaging/Quantity

The EFM8UB20F64G-B-QFP48R is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• Architecture: 8-bit
  • CPU Speed: Up to 50 MHz
  • Flash Memory: 64 KB
  • RAM: 4 KB
  • Operating Voltage: 1.8V - 3.6V
  • Digital I/O Pins: 32
  • Analog Inputs: 12-bit ADC with up to 16 channels
  • Communication Interfaces: UART, SPI, I2C
  • Timers/Counters: Multiple timers/counters for precise timing operations
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The EFM8UB20F64G-B-QFP48R has a total of 48 pins, each serving a specific purpose. The pin configuration is as follows:

(Pin diagram goes here)

Functional Features

  • High-speed processing capabilities
  • Efficient power management
  • Integrated peripherals for enhanced functionality
  • Robust communication interfaces for seamless data transfer
  • Flexible and configurable I/O options
  • Timers/counters for precise timing operations
  • Analog-to-Digital Converter (ADC) for accurate analog signal processing

Advantages and Disadvantages

Advantages

  • High-performance microcontroller suitable for a wide range of applications
  • Low power consumption for energy-efficient designs
  • Compact form factor allows for space-saving integration
  • Extensive memory options for storing program code and data
  • Versatile communication interfaces enable seamless connectivity

Disadvantages

  • Limited processing capabilities compared to higher-bit microcontrollers
  • Relatively small amount of RAM may restrict complex data manipulation
  • Availability of alternative models with more features or lower cost

Working Principles

The EFM8UB20F64G-B-QFP48R operates based on the principles of digital logic and microcontroller architecture. It executes instructions stored in its flash memory, processes input signals, and generates output signals accordingly. The microcontroller's internal components, such as the CPU, memory, and peripherals, work together to perform various tasks and control external devices.

Detailed Application Field Plans

The EFM8UB20F64G-B-QFP48R finds applications in a wide range of fields, including but not limited to: - Industrial automation - Consumer electronics - Internet of Things (IoT) devices - Home automation systems - Automotive electronics - Medical devices

Detailed and Complete Alternative Models

  • EFM8UB10F16G-B-QFN24: Similar microcontroller with reduced flash memory and fewer pins.
  • EFM8UB30F32G-B-QFP32: Higher-end microcontroller with increased flash memory and additional peripherals.
  • EFM8UB40F64G-B-QFP48: Upgraded version with larger flash memory and extended temperature range.

(Note: This is not an exhaustive list of alternative models. Please refer to the manufacturer's documentation for a complete list.)

In conclusion, the EFM8UB20F64G-B-QFP48R microcontroller offers high-performance and low-power capabilities, making it suitable for various applications. Its compact size, integrated peripherals, and robust communication interfaces contribute to its versatility. While it may have limitations in terms of processing power and memory, there are alternative models available with different specifications to cater to specific requirements.

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de EFM8UB20F64G-B-QFP48R en soluciones técnicas

Sure! Here are 10 common questions and answers related to the application of EFM8UB20F64G-B-QFP48R in technical solutions:

  1. Q: What is the EFM8UB20F64G-B-QFP48R microcontroller used for? A: The EFM8UB20F64G-B-QFP48R microcontroller is commonly used in various technical solutions, including industrial automation, consumer electronics, and Internet of Things (IoT) applications.

  2. Q: What is the maximum clock frequency supported by the EFM8UB20F64G-B-QFP48R? A: The EFM8UB20F64G-B-QFP48R supports a maximum clock frequency of 50 MHz.

  3. Q: How much flash memory does the EFM8UB20F64G-B-QFP48R have? A: The EFM8UB20F64G-B-QFP48R has 64 KB of flash memory for program storage.

  4. Q: Can I use the EFM8UB20F64G-B-QFP48R for analog signal processing? A: Yes, the EFM8UB20F64G-B-QFP48R has built-in analog peripherals, such as ADCs and DACs, which make it suitable for analog signal processing applications.

  5. Q: Does the EFM8UB20F64G-B-QFP48R support communication protocols like UART, SPI, and I2C? A: Yes, the EFM8UB20F64G-B-QFP48R supports UART, SPI, and I2C communication interfaces, making it compatible with a wide range of peripheral devices.

  6. Q: What is the operating voltage range of the EFM8UB20F64G-B-QFP48R? A: The EFM8UB20F64G-B-QFP48R operates within a voltage range of 1.8V to 3.6V.

  7. Q: Can I use the EFM8UB20F64G-B-QFP48R in battery-powered applications? A: Yes, the low power consumption and voltage range of the EFM8UB20F64G-B-QFP48R make it suitable for battery-powered applications.

  8. Q: Does the EFM8UB20F64G-B-QFP48R have any built-in security features? A: Yes, the EFM8UB20F64G-B-QFP48R includes hardware features like a unique device identifier (UID) and a hardware CRC engine for enhanced security.

  9. Q: Can I program the EFM8UB20F64G-B-QFP48R using a standard development toolchain? A: Yes, the EFM8UB20F64G-B-QFP48R is compatible with popular development tools like the Silicon Labs Simplicity Studio IDE and supports programming via JTAG or UART interfaces.

  10. Q: Are there any application examples or reference designs available for the EFM8UB20F64G-B-QFP48R? A: Yes, Silicon Labs provides various application notes, reference designs, and example code that can help you get started with the EFM8UB20F64G-B-QFP48R in different technical solutions.

Please note that the answers provided here are general and may vary depending on specific requirements and use cases.